Special Dietary Accommodations
Inclusivity is key when designing a breakroom menu. Many employees have dietary restrictions due to allergies, medical conditions, or personal choices.
Accommodating these needs fosters a supportive and respectful workplace culture.
Clearly labeling items and providing alternatives ensures everyone feels considered and comfortable.
Dietary Need | Menu Suggestions | Considerations |
---|---|---|
Gluten-Free | Rice Cakes, Gluten-Free Granola Bars, Fresh Fruit | Avoid cross-contamination, clear labeling |
Vegan | Hummus with Veggies, Nut Mixes, Plant-Based Protein Bars | No animal products, watch for hidden ingredients |
Nut-Free | Seed Mixes, Dried Fruit, Pretzels | Strict separation from nut-containing snacks |
Low-Sugar | Unsweetened Yogurt, Fresh Vegetables, Cheese Cubes | Limit processed sugars, natural sweetness preferred |

Tips for Maintaining an Effective Breakroom Menu
Curating the perfect breakroom menu goes beyond just selecting items. Proper maintenance, feedback collection, and thoughtful variety make a lasting impact on employee satisfaction.
- Regularly assess inventory: Monitor which items are popular and which are not to optimize stock and reduce waste.
- Solicit employee feedback: Use surveys or suggestion boxes to understand preferences and dietary needs.
- Ensure freshness: Rotate perishable items frequently and maintain proper storage conditions.
- Promote healthy choices: Highlight nutritious options with signage or incentives.
- Keep pricing fair: If snacks and drinks are sold, maintain affordable pricing to encourage participation.
